A wheel loader is a versatile piece of heavy equipment designed for tasks such as material handling, loading trucks, and excavation. Given its importance in many operations, buying the right wheel loader is crucial to ensuring productivity and efficiency on the job site. Determine Your Specific Needs

The first step is to consider the tasks you will be using the wheel loader for and the environment in which it will operate. For instance, if you are working in a confined space, a compact wheel loader might be more suitable. On the other hand, if you need to move large volumes of material, a larger model with a higher load capacity will be necessary. Understanding the type of materials you'll be handling, the required lift height, and the typical working conditions will help you choose a loader with the appropriate specifications.

Consider Engine Power

Higher horsepower engines provide more power, which is necessary for demanding tasks, but they also consume more fuel. It’s important to balance the engine power with fuel efficiency, especially if the wheel loader will be in continuous use. Look for models that offer advanced fuel management systems or eco-friendly modes that help reduce fuel consumption without compromising performance.

Focus on Comfort

Operator comfort is a key factor that can influence productivity and safety on the job site. When buying a wheel loader, consider the ergonomics of the cab design, including the layout of controls, seat comfort, and visibility. A well-designed cab with easy-to-use controls reduces operator fatigue and enhances efficiency.

Assess the Machine’s Build Quality

The durability of a wheel loader is critical for long-term performance. Inspect the materials used in the construction of the loader, paying attention to the frame, boom, and bucket. Choosing a well-built machine from a reputable brand can save you from frequent repairs and downtime, ensuring a better return on investment.
